Terumo Radifocus Optitorque Angiographic Catheter 4 Fr 1.4 mm 100 cm 0 side holes | REF RH-4AL2000M

The Terumo Radifocus Optitorque Angiographic Catheter (REF RH-4AL2000M) is a 4 Fr diagnostic angiographic catheter designed for transradial and transfemoral diagnostic procedures. With a 1.4 mm outer diameter and a 100 cm working length, it offers a balance of torque response and pushability intended for selective vessel cannulation.

Key Features
- 4 Fr (1.4 mm) catheter profile
- 100 cm working length
- 0 side holes (end-hole only configuration)
- Optitorque shaft engineered for 1:1 torque transmission
- Hydrophilic Radifocus M coating to support smooth navigation
- Preformed tip geometry for selective angiography

Clinical Applications
- Diagnostic angiography of selective arterial territories
- Transradial and transfemoral diagnostic access
- Contrast media injection during catheter-based imaging
- Use as part of standard diagnostic catheterization workflows
